Planning commission recommends approval of rezoning for Tibbets property with reduced stipulations

Summary

The Paulding County Planning Commission voted 5-0-1 to recommend rezoning of about 28.05 acres owned by Russell W. Tibbets from R-2 to R-1/A-1 for a rural residential subdivision, approving only staff stipulations 1 and 2 and striking stipulations 3 and 4; the applicant must appear before the Board of Commissioners on June 10 at 2 p.m.

Applicant Russell W. Tibbets requested rezoning of approximately 28.05 acres along Highway 101 South south of Buck Canyon Highway (State Route 120) from R-2 suburban residential to R-1/A-1 to allow a rural residential subdivision. The Paulding County Planning Commission voted 5-0-1 to forward the rezoning to the Board of Commissioners with a recommendation of approval subject to stipulations 1 and 2 and with stipulations 3 and 4 removed.

Why it matters: The rezoning would enable development of a low-density subdivision on land in Commission Post 2; the applicant said soil results reduced the expected lot count well below the original 21-lot concept, changing infrastructure and access expectations that informed staff recommendations.
